Find LCM of 442,390,786,603,655 with Prime Factorization
2 | 442, 390, 786, 603, 655 |
3 | 221, 195, 393, 603, 655 |
5 | 221, 65, 131, 201, 655 |
13 | 221, 13, 131, 201, 131 |
131 | 17, 1, 131, 201, 131 |
17, 1, 1, 201, 1 |
Multiply the prime numbers at the bottom and the left side.
2 x 3 x 5 x 13 x 131 x 17 x 1 x 1 x 201 x 1 = 174574530
Therefore, the lowest common multiple of 442,390,786,603,655 is 174574530.
